Output 8b4e11b0fd29fb68fa6fe44090a8d1502db08f2ff7ddf64bc959eae796ed227b:0

value
6853973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f895f307ed6a01d7152632d0d6ae737fc523be36 OP_EQUAL
address
3QMR8nDmDNtHs72YZPaSxPH1EHPpLyQkZZ
transaction
8b4e11b0fd29fb68fa6fe44090a8d1502db08f2ff7ddf64bc959eae796ed227b
confirmations
685
spent
true